
BMW has never put out an all-electric SUV before, so we know we're in for a real treat when the iX finally arrives in 2022. The BMW iX is expected to be roughly the size of the X5, but it's going to have an all-electric powertrain, finally bringing the BMW SUV up to modern standards. BMW has thrown in an impressive number of fashionable exterior upgrades as well, such as the mostly body-colored grille with a stunning centerpiece decoration.
Performance and Features of the BMW iX
While we have received little news of the iX so far, we can expect the newly developed BMW iX to output at least 500 horsepower, allowing this electric crossover to go from 0 to 60 in less than 5 seconds. This is a stunning achievement for any electric SUV. On the inside, the iX is dressed for luxury and technology. Early release notes show that it will have a large 14.9-inch touchscreen interface that's placed just right for the driver and passenger to interact with. A 1615 watt "4D" Bowers & Wilkins premium audio system is also set to debut in the iX. Did we mention that the touchscreen infotainment system will have a lively curved screen for even greater immersion in its advanced features? And this is a BMW, so we know that the iX will feature some of today's most luxurious and exotic leather choices as well.
